By using a reverse cell phone search you can find out someone's full name, address and background information by having only their phone number. This can come handy in many different situations - let's have a look to see how it is done.
As you might imagine, this type of service will usually cost a few bucks, but there is a way to get the same information for free.
Grab the phone number that you are "investigating" and fire up your computer. Go to Google and type in the phone number in this format: "555-555-5555" (include the quotation marks). Press the search button and wait for your results to come up.
In this case we are hoping that this phone number has found it's way on the world wide web at some point in time. People will leave their phone number on webpages for different reasons - this is needed for filling out a classified ad or even filling out some types of 'profile' pages. If this number has ever been published online, Google is your best bet to find it.
Look over the results that come up and see if you have a match. If you see that the number is on a webpage, take a close look to see what you can find out about the owner. Hopefully you can see their name and address along with other details. You would be surprised by how much information will be left about someone on just a webpage.
